Intended Use

The TST Control Integrator for Steam Autoclave is a steam sterilization process indicator designed to indicate, through a yellow to blue color change, when a combination of parameters necessary for sterilization (270°F for 3 minutes) have been achieved.

Device Story

Device is a chemical sterilization process indicator; consists of paper strip with pH-sensitive chemical ink. Used in steam autoclaves to monitor sterilization cycles. Input: exposure to saturated steam at 270°F for 3 minutes. Transformation: chemical reaction triggered by time, temperature, and steam presence; ink changes color from yellow to blue when parameters are met. Output: visual color change on strip. Used by healthcare personnel to verify sterilization conditions. Benefits patient by providing confirmation that sterilization parameters were achieved, ensuring instruments are safe for use.

Clinical Evidence

Bench testing only. Performance evaluated in BIER/Steam vessels per ANSI/AAMI ST45-1992. Testing confirmed color change occurs only upon exposure to saturated steam at 270°F for 3 minutes. Side-by-side testing with biological indicators demonstrated a safety margin for spore kill. Stability testing confirmed color change remains stable for at least 5 years; shelf-life validated at 3 years.

Technological Characteristics

Paper strip with pH-based chemical indicator ink. Color change mechanism is pH-dependent. Dimensions/form factor not specified. Standalone device. No energy source required. Sterilization method: steam autoclave.

Regulatory Classification

Identification

Biological sterilization process indicator: A device intended for use by a health care provider to accompany products being sterilized through a sterilization procedure and to monitor adequacy of sterilization. The device consists of a known number of microorganisms, of known resistance to the mode of sterilization, in or on a carrier and enclosed in a protective package. Subsequent growth or failure of the microorganisms to grow under suitable conditions indicates the adequacy of sterilization. Physical/chemical sterilization process indicator: A device intended for use by a health care provider to accompany products being sterilized through a sterilization procedure and to monitor one or more parameters of the sterilization process. The adequacy of the sterilization conditions as measured by these parameters is indicated by a visible change in the device.

DEVICE DESCRIPTION Albert Browne Ltd. received clearance for a TST Control Integrator for Steam Autoclave, K902958, which monitored sterilization cycles with a holding temperature/time combinations of 250°F (121°C)/15 min. The purpose of this submission is to expand the process parameter combinations to include a cycle of 270°F/3 min. Like the integrator described in K902958, the TST steam integrator discussed in this amendment changes color from yellow to blue when a specific set of process parameters required for steam sterilization to occur have been met. The parameters of the sterilization cycle monitored by the proposed integrator - time, temperature and the presence of steam - are equivalent to those monitored by the integrators described in K902958. Albert Browne Ltd. is amending K902958 in order to increase the combinations of parameters which produce a color change to include additional temperatures. The time-temperature combinations in sterilization cycles which will induce TST Control Integrators to change color from yellow to blue are presented in Table 1. TECHNOLOGICAL CHARACTERISTICS The TST steam integrator consists of a paper strip with the chemical indicator ink located on one end. The color change is pH based. The time and temperature required for the color change to occur is precisely controlled through manipulation of the chemical composition of the ink. ## 7. PERFORMANCE TESTING All performance testing was conducted in a BIER vessel/prototype which conforms to the performance requirements for BIER/Steam vessels described in ANSI/AAMI ST45-1992. Testing was conducted to evaluate the performance of the strips in partial and full cycles. The data showed that the strips changed color only when exposed to saturated steam for 3 minutes at 270°F, confirming that the integrators will accurately report exposure to those conditions. Side by side testing was performed with biological indicators. The results showed that the temperature/time required for color change to occur provides wide safety margin over that necessary to kill the spores on a biological indicator, indicating that the conditions required for a color change to occur are sufficient for sterilization. Additional testing was performed which demonstrated that the color change was stable at least 5 years after exposure. All strips used for testing were all ≥3 years from the date of manufacture, demonstrating that the 3 year expiration date is adequate to ensure accurate, reproducible performance.
